What Makes Natural Soy Scented Candles Special?

Natural soy scented candles have become increasingly popular among health-conscious consumers and environmental advocates. Unlike traditional paraffin wax candles derived from petroleum, soy wax comes from soybeans, making it a renewable and biodegradable resource. Soy candles burn cleaner, producing significantly less soot and releasing fewer toxins into the air. They also burn slower and cooler than paraffin alternatives, providing longer-lasting fragrance and better value.

The porous nature of soy wax allows it to hold and release essential oils more effectively, resulting in a more consistent and natural scent throw throughout the candle’s life. Many artisan candlemakers prefer soy wax because it creates a smooth, creamy appearance and can be easily blended with natural colorants and botanicals. For those with sensitivities to synthetic fragrances or air quality concerns, natural soy candles offer a gentler alternative that doesn’t compromise on aromatic experience.

How Do Aromatherapy Essential Oil Candles Work?

Aromatherapy essential oil candles are crafted by infusing pure essential oils into the wax base, allowing the therapeutic properties of plants to be released as the candle burns. Different essential oils offer distinct benefits: lavender promotes relaxation and sleep, eucalyptus supports respiratory health and mental clarity, peppermint energizes and enhances focus, while citrus oils like lemon and orange uplift mood and reduce anxiety.

The effectiveness of aromatherapy candles depends on several factors, including the quality and concentration of essential oils used, the type of wax, and proper burning techniques. High-quality aromatherapy candles typically contain 6-10% essential oil concentration to ensure therapeutic benefits without overwhelming the senses. When selecting aromatherapy candles, look for products that clearly list their essential oil content and avoid those with synthetic fragrances, which lack therapeutic properties and may contain potentially harmful chemicals.

To maximize benefits, burn your aromatherapy candles in well-ventilated spaces for 1-3 hours at a time, allowing the scent to disperse naturally without becoming overpowering. Creating a ritual around candle lighting—perhaps during meditation, bath time, or evening relaxation—can enhance the psychological benefits of aromatherapy.

What Defines Luxury Home Fragrance Candles?

Luxury home fragrance candles distinguish themselves through superior ingredients, sophisticated scent compositions, and meticulous craftsmanship. These premium products often feature complex fragrance profiles that evolve as the candle burns, revealing top, middle, and base notes similar to fine perfumes. The wax itself may be a proprietary blend designed to optimize scent throw and burn quality.

High-end candle brands invest significantly in fragrance development, working with master perfumers to create unique, memorable scents that cannot be replicated by mass-market producers. The vessels housing luxury candles are often works of art themselves—hand-blown glass, ceramic containers, or elegantly designed tins that can be repurposed after the candle has burned completely.

Beyond aesthetics, luxury candles typically use lead-free cotton or wood wicks that burn cleanly and evenly, and they undergo rigorous testing to ensure consistent performance. The investment in a luxury candle reflects not just the product itself but the entire sensory experience it provides, from the moment you open the packaging to the final flicker of the flame.

How Are Hand-Poured Herbal Scented Candles Made?

Hand-poured herbal scented candles represent the intersection of traditional craftsmanship and botanical wellness. The process begins with carefully selecting and blending wax—often soy, beeswax, or coconut wax—with dried herbs, flowers, and essential oils. Each candle is individually crafted, with artisans monitoring temperature, pouring technique, and curing time to ensure optimal quality.

The hand-pouring process allows for greater control over ingredient distribution, ensuring that herbs and botanicals are evenly dispersed throughout the candle rather than settling at the bottom. Many candlemakers incorporate visible dried flowers, lavender buds, rose petals, or chamomile into their designs, creating visually stunning pieces that celebrate the natural ingredients within.

Herbal candles often feature rustic, earthy scents that connect users to nature and traditional healing practices. Common herbal combinations include sage and cedar for purification, rosemary and thyme for mental clarity, or chamomile and vanilla for relaxation. The small-batch nature of hand-poured candles means each piece carries the maker’s intention and care, resulting in products that feel personal and authentic.
